ITA reveals the Number of Vehicles imported in BiH

Published: January 25, 2026
Share
SHARE

In 2025, 95.421 vehicles were imported into Bosnia and Herzegovina (BiH), which is 6.214 more than in the previous year, the Indirect Taxation Authority (ITA) of BiH confirmed.

The total value of imported vehicles amounted to 1.145.335.182.32 BAM, of which 262.720.176.34 BAM in duties was paid.

Of the total number, 9.292 were new vehicles, while 86.129 were used.

Last year, 3.743 hybrid vehicles were imported, of which 2.043 were new, and 1.700 were used.

This represents a significant increase compared to 2024, when 2.408 hybrid-powered vehicles were imported.

When it comes to electric vehicles, the situation is the opposite, as 207 were imported in 2025, which is fewer than the year before, when 230 such vehicles were imported.

According to BIHAMK data, during 2025, a total of 1.355.856 road vehicles were registered in BiH, which represents an increase of 60.632 vehicles, or 4.68 percent, compared to the previous year.

The average age of road motor vehicles in BiH is 17 years.
